Product development: RUO Device for selective cell lysis
Cellectric is developing novel sample-preparation devices for life-science research. Our systems combine electronics, embedded software, fluidics, mechanics, and thermal control in compact laboratory instruments.
We are looking for a hands-on embedded systems engineer with focus on product development who will take technical ownership of electronics and embedded software while working closely with mechanics, manufacturing, and external regulatory and development partners.
This role is highly practical and product-driven: from schematic to firmware to assembled product on the bench.
